How to Wear Convertible Pants

Fashion designers are constantly finding ways to reinvent staple items. The introduction of the convertible pant, which is heavily influenced by the cargo pant and short, gives you the freedom to have a two-for-one value. This versatility also offers the fashion-conscious shopper the opportunity to easily transition ensembles by injecting mix-and-match wardrobe pieces. By changing your top, shoes and accessories, you can interchange your convertible pants into endless ensemble combinations. Does this Spark an idea?

Instructions

    • 1

      Try on your convertible pants in front of your full-length mirror. Notice the types of trims used throughout your pant. For example, if your convertible uses mostly zippers throughout the garment, you can select a full zipper front athletic top with pocket details for leisure wear. Transform your look completely with a half-zip polo top for a casual wear ensemble.

    • 2

      Detach the bottom portion of your pant. View where the inseam finishes. Some convertibles offer a below-the-knee inseam and certain styles convert into a walking short version with a 10-inch inseam for warm weather. If your pant has multiple cargo-inspired pockets, see where the pockets are positioned once you convert the style. This will impact the amount of different ensemble combinations you can wear, as well as influence your footwear selection. Options include athletic or ballet shoes. Heel heights also play a role.

    • 3

      Look at your waistband finish. If your pant has a decorative drawstring front, your ensemble will look best with a tucked-in, contoured top. Beltloop width as well as your pant's front and back rise finish will impact the type of belt accessory you can wear.

    • 4

      Check your pant's fabric texture and content. Although most convertible pants are available in light- and medium-weight nylons, there are also brushed twill and canvas versions. You can opt to wear your pant version with a button-down cotton blouse for a weekend wear look. You can also interchange it with your short version and a one-shoulder or off-the-shoulder top for a casual ensemble.

    • 5

      Select your belt, accessories and shoes. It is best to select these pieces once you have determined which convertible version you will be wearing along with a top selection.
